Breaking: #ToryLeadershipRace: Rishi Sunak is next UK PM as Mordaunt drops out
Rishi Sunak will be the UK’s next prime minister after Penny Mordaunt dropped out of the Tory leadership race in the final minutes before nominations closed.
CityNews Nigeria Sunak will succeed Liz Truss seven weeks after she defeated him in the previous Tory contest.
The ex-chancellor gained the support of well over half of Tory MPs, with Mordaunt struggling to reach the 100 MP threshold.
He will become the UK’s first British Asian PM and at 42, the youngest in more than a century
Labour have reiterated their call for a general election, as have the Scottish National Party.
